Conditions

pediatric cardiac surgery

Interventions

Control group:The children in control group achieved 2.8 ~ 3.2L/ (min·m2) perfusion flow rate according to their weight, body surface area and CPB temperature.
Experimental group:In experimental group, DO2i, calculated by blood gas test results, was maintained over the minimum safety threshold which was obtained from the second part of the experiment during

Eligibility

Sex/Gender
All

Inclusion criteria

Inclusion criteria: Pediatric patients undergoing cardiopulmonary bypass in our hospital were eligible for participation if they met the following criteria: 1) aged ? 3 year; 2) undergoing elective cardiac surgery under CPB; 3) ASA I - III level; 4) there is written informed consent.

Exclusion criteria

Exclusion criteria: 1) redo cardiac surgery; 2) severe renal disease (receipt of dialysis or a serum creatinine level >3.0 mg/dL); 3) current infections (e.g. sepsis); 4) preoperative treatment with gentamicin and vancomycin in the last seven days; 5) preoperative treatment with radiotherapy; 6) preoperative treatment with extracorporeal life support; 7) incomplete clinical data that statistical analysis could not be completed; 8) deep hypothermic CPB.

Design outcomes

Primary

MeasureTime frame
The incidence of AKI after cardiac surgery, pRIFLE as the diagnostic criteria for AKI;

Secondary

MeasureTime frame
Regional cerebral or renal oxygen saturation;awake time;extubation time;length of stay in hospital;length of stay in intensive care unit;mortality rate;severe complications;Total fluid intake and output (including the incidence of postoperative RBC infusion and transfusion volume);VIS score;
